ABOUT ME
Born1982 in Lagos, Aderemi Adegbite is a documentary photographer/video artist. He considers photography as a tool, to engage society in discourse. His photo “N65,” won the Emerging Human Rights Activists award of the World Youth Movement for Democracy 2012 Photo Contest. And with this, he participated at the Seventh Assembly of the World Movement for Democracy which held in Lima, Peru in 2012.
